









Welcome to Upper East on Grand, Historic Downtown Escondido’s newest neighborhood restaurant and bar. Locally owned and located in the “Upper East” area of San Diego County, our ambiance offers a nostalgic nod to the timeless charm of the Escondido culture. We pride ourselves on selling quality food and beverages. Our menu is compiled of our spin on classic American dishes as well as some favorites from our sister restaurant, Knotty Barrel Rancho Peñasquitos. Enjoy our locally sourced menu with a full bar offering seasonal cocktails and some classics with a twist, as well as a wide array of domestic, imported and local craft beers on our 20 taps.
